SUMMARY
Paragon Professional Services, a company within the BSNC family is currently seeking a qualified Technical Editor for Folsom, California. The Technical Editor supports a federal environmental remediation contractor by editing, formatting, and performing quality control on technical documents prepared for government clients. This position ensures that reports, work plans, and correspondence are clear, consistent, and compliant with federal regulations, contract requirements, and style guides. The Technical Editor works closely with project managers, scientists, engineers, and regulatory specialists to produce high-quality deliverables for agencies such as the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A), U.S. Department of Defense (DoD), and U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E).

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ES
The Essential Duties and Responsibilities are intended to present a descriptive list of the range of duties performed for this position and are not intended to reflect all duties performed within the job. Other duties may be assigned.
Edit and proofread technical and regulatory documents for clarity, consistency, grammar, and accuracy while preserving technical meaning
Format reports, plans, and other documents to comply with contract specifications, templates, and style guides
Review documents for internal consistency, including figures, tables, citations, acronyms, and cross-references
Ensure compliance with federal environmental regulations and documentation standards (e.g., CERCLA and RCRA)
Coordinate with project teams to resolve editorial comments and incorporate revisions efficiently
Maintain document version control and support quality assurance/quality control (QA/QC) processes
Prepare documents for submission, including final formatting, pagination, and electronic deliverables
Assist in developing and maintaining document templates and style standards
Support proposal development and marketing material, as needed.
